How do you UV unwrap in blender? Or add textures to a weapon?

to add textures, get the bit you want and give it a material name the material in the links section of the weapon, where it shows the colour preview, usually of a sphere in the bit that says MA:material.001 or whetver. Change that to black75 or red or whatever you are using and when you export it, you need to have a 16x16 png named red or whatever you called it in the folder and zip with the weapon.
